What Makes a Bike “High Mileage”? Key Factors

Before jumping into the list, it is critical to understand why mileage figures on paper often differ from what you experience on the road.

  • Riding conditions: Stop-and-go city traffic reduces mileage significantly; highway riding with smooth throttle control increases it.
  • Tyre pressure: Under-inflated tyres increase rolling resistance and consume more fuel.
  • Engine displacement: Smaller 100cc engines are tuned purely for efficiency; 125cc bikes balance power and economy.
  • Maintenance habits: Skipping oil changes or running on a dirty air filter can drop mileage by 5–8 kmpl within a year.

Why it tops the list: The TVS Star City Plus delivers an incredible claimed 83.09 kmpl, making it the highest mileage bike in India by ARAI figures. Its EcoThrust engine and TVS’s Intelligo technology automatically switches the engine off at prolonged stops.

Best for: Urban commuters who prioritise fuel economy above everything else.

Pros

Best-in-class claimed mileage, LED headlamp, comfortable ergonomics.

Cons

Less brand recognition compared to Hero/Honda in rural areas.

Why it ranks here: The Bajaj Platina 100 is a legend in the commuter segment. Tuned for low-revving, high-efficiency performance, it is one of the most fuel-efficient bikes in India for daily commuting. It uses Advanced Comfortec suspension, making rough roads far less punishing.

Best for: Budget-conscious daily commuters and rural riders.

Pros

Exceptional fuel savings, low maintenance, long comfortable seats.

Cons

Kick-start only on base variant, very basic feature set.

Why it ranks here: If there is one name that defines high-mileage bikes in India, it is the Hero Splendor. The XTEC 2.0 variant adds tech like i3S (Idle Start-Stop), Bluetooth, and a Real-time Mileage Indicator. Best-in-class reliability with a vast service network.

Best for: Daily commuters who want tech features without sacrificing mileage.

Pros

i3S saves fuel at signals, RTMI helps monitor efficiency.

Cons

Slightly premium-priced for a 100cc bike.

Electric Bikes vs Petrol High-Mileage Bikes

With the rise of electric two-wheelers in India, many commuters are weighing EVs against high-mileage petrol bikes.   • A typical EV like the Revolt RV1 offers a 100 km range per charge and costs roughly ₹0.15 per km to run.
  • A Bajaj Platina 100 at 80 kmpl costs approximately ₹1.31 per km.
  • Over 30,000 km, an EV saves approximately ₹36,000 in running costs versus a petrol bike.

Frequently Asked Questions

Which is the best mileage bike in India in 2026?

The TVS Star City Plus delivers the highest ARAI-certified mileage of 83 kmpl. For the most trusted option, the Hero Splendor Plus XTEC 2.0 at 80 kmpl is the market leader.

Which bike gives 100 kmpl mileage in India?

No bike currently offers a verified 100 kmpl in real-world conditions. However, the Bajaj CT 100 and Bajaj Platina 100 are the closest.

What is the best mileage bike under ₹1 lakh?

The Hero Splendor Plus XTEC 2.0 (₹83,700) offers the best combination of mileage, features, and reliability under ₹1 lakh. The Bajaj Platina 100 (₹68,800) is the best pure mileage option.

Which is the best mileage 125cc bike in India?

The Hero Super Splendor XTEC (69 kmpl) leads the 125cc segment, closely followed by the Honda SP 125 (65 kmpl) and Hero Xtreme 125R (66 kmpl).

Does mileage vary between city and highway riding?

Yes, significantly. Stop-and-go city traffic reduces mileage; smooth highway riding with consistent throttle helps you achieve or exceed claimed ARAI figures.

Which sports bike gives the best mileage in India?

The TVS Apache RTR 160 4V and Yamaha FZ-S Fi offer a good balance of sporty performance and decent fuel economy (45-50 kmpl).

What maintenance gives the best mileage improvement?

Clean air filters, timely engine oil changes, and correct tyre pressure are the three highest-impact maintenance actions for maintaining peak mileage.

Is the Hero Splendor Plus XTEC worth buying over the regular Splendor Plus?

Yes. The XTEC 2.0 adds i3S (idle stop-start), RTMI, Bluetooth, and a digital console over the standard model for a ₹3,500–₹5,000 premium. The i3S alone recovers some of that cost difference.
